Speikboden – Skiworld Ahrntal, a mid-sized ski resort, is known for its excellent snow quality and variety of skiing experiences. It caters to a broad range of skill levels with slopes ranging from easy to very steep. The ski area is family-friendly and includes features such as Dinoland, a snow park, and a speed track. The resort comes equipped with comfortable gondolas and chair lifts, enhancing the overall skiing experience.
The resort is also a fantastic starting point for mountain trips, offering great cabins and a plethora of restaurants. It also has a cable car service that transports visitors to a plateau at an altitude of 2000 metres. This area is well-equipped with a mini zoo, a restaurant, and a playground. Visitors can then take a chairlift to the panoramic tower at an altitude of 2500 metres, which provides a breathtaking view of the Aurine peaks.
